Problem solved….

I’ve just updated the firmware on the Lite-On LTD-165H DVDROM drive from CH0E to CH0N. I’m pleased to report that this upgrade has cured my hard drive ‘busy’ light being on all the time. Also, the ‘busy’ light no longer flashes when playing CDs or DVDs. :)

The only thing is, the name of the drive has changed to a JLMS from a Lite-On. This doesn’t bother me, but the drive is still auto-detected in the BIOS as PIO Mode 4 and Ultra DMA Mode 3. :confused:

Does this make any difference? I know the drive cannot perform faster than Mode 2, so should I leave it alone or should I change the ‘AUTO’ detect to ‘CDROM’ and enter Ultra DMA Mode 2 manually?

The name change comes from the fact that Lite-on has merged with JVC. JLMS stand for Jvc LiteonIT Manufacturing and Sales! Or something like that :D
